Background technology
Drain tank is a kind of discharge structure that must implement installation in science of bridge building, is typically mainly mounted on bridge On roadbed side slope, realized by drain tank and quickly sluiced so that the ponding on bridge can realize quick discharge, so So that ponding situation is not present in whole bridge floor so that vehicle operation is more safe.
Current drain tank is spliced using cement block more, but during the use of reality, cement block structure is easy Influenceed situation about bursting occur by temperature, so that drainage procedure is not very smooth, and because bridge floor can be possible There is soil, therefore in the case of the torrential wash of larger rainfall so that occur the blocking of soil in drain tank, while cause whole The drainage effect of body is bad, it is therefore desirable to is improved.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the embodiment of the utility model is carried out Clearly and completely describing, it is clear that described embodiment is only the utility model part of the embodiment, rather than whole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not under the premise of creative work is made The every other embodiment obtained, belong to the scope of the utility model protection.
Fig. 1-2 is referred to, the utility model provides a kind of technical scheme:A kind of science of bridge building plastic composite sluices Groove, including sluicing groove body 2, the upper end of sluicing groove body 2 are provided with along side 1, and bolt hole 8, sluicing groove body are provided with along side 1 2 one end are provided with projection 3, and the other end of sluicing groove body 2 is provided with the groove 7 with raised 3 corresponding connections, the bottom of sluicing groove body 2 End is provided with horizontal reinforcement strip 5, and the side of sluicing groove body 2 is provided with longitudinal reinforcement bar 4, the bending place inside sluicing groove body 2 Reinforcement block 6 is provided with, the section of reinforcement block 6 is arranged to arc-shaped structure, and neck 9 is provided with along side 1, and neck 9 is located at respectively Along the both ends of side 1, during if necessary to groove lid, groove lid is buckled in neck 9, sluicing groove body 2 is arranged to engineering plastics and answered Condensation material layer, makes that the rigidity of sluicing groove body 2 is big, creep is small, high mechanical strength, heat-resist, avoids sluicing groove body from bursting, lets out Glass layer is provided with the inwall of sink main body 2, glass layer strengthens product portraitlandscape power;And pass through glass fibre Layer, it is more firm in structure.In actual production, the science of bridge building plastic composite drain tank be provided with it is mutually isostructural not Same specifications and models.
Operation principle:It will be connected between adjacent drain tank by projection 3 and groove 7, sluicing groove body 2 passed through It is bolted on bridge, during if necessary to groove lid, groove lid is buckled in neck 9, horizontal reinforcement strip 5 and longitudinal reinforcement Bar 4, enhances the intensity of drain tank, and glass layer strengthens product portraitlandscape power;And by glass layer, in structure It is more firm.
